Set Shakur, the sister of the late legendary rapper Tupac, in a recent interview with TMZ, slammed Alina Habba, Donald Trump's attorney, for comparing Trump to her brother.
Habba had made comments suggesting that
Trump's legal troubles would boost his poll numbers, just like Tupac's record
sales went up following his bid for presidency.
Set Shakur called Habba's comparison
"blasphemous" and emphasized that her brother was measured by his
integrity, principles, and personal and collective responsibility.

She pointed out that during Tupac's 1994
sexual abuse trial, he took accountability, unlike Trump. She also highlighted
that Tupac's popularity did not come from his time in prison, but rather from
people listening to his music and measuring him by his words and actions that
aligned.
Habba's comparison between Trump and Tupac
came as Trump is reportedly preparing to turn himself in for hush money
payments he allegedly made to porn star Stormy Daniels in 2016.
Habba had stated on The Benny Show that
"Donald Trump is Tupac. Donald Trump's Biggie Smalls, he's better than
Tupac. I'm east coast, so I love Biggie. Donald Trump is his own brand. He is
everything. This is just gonna boost him, we've seen it in the polls. It's not
a question, it's a fact."
Currently, Trump is in New York City ahead of
his arraignment hearing on Tuesday, where he will be the first-ever U.S.
president to be criminally charged for allegedly making hush-money payments to
Stormy Daniels in order to prevent her from speaking about their alleged sexual
relationship.
